What does fabricated mean?

verb

  1. To form into a whole by uniting its parts; to construct; to build.

    to fabricate a bridge or ship

  2. To form by art and labor; to manufacture; to produce.

    to fabricate computer chips

adjective

  1. Constructed or assembled.
  2. False in the sense of made-up, constructed.
